What is compound medications prior authorization?
Compound medications prior authorization is a process that requires healthcare providers to obtain approval from an insurance company or payer before a compound medication can be covered by the patient's insurance plan.
Who is required to file compound medications prior authorization?
Healthcare providers, such as physicians or pharmacists, are typically required to file for compound medications prior authorization on behalf of their patients.
How to fill out compound medications prior authorization?
To fill out a compound medications prior authorization, a provider must complete a form provided by the insurance company, detailing the patient's information, the prescribed compound medication, clinical justification, and any supporting documentation.
What is the purpose of compound medications prior authorization?
The purpose of compound medications prior authorization is to ensure that the prescribed compound medication is medically necessary and meets the payer's guidelines for coverage, thereby preventing misuse and ensuring cost-effectiveness.
What information must be reported on compound medications prior authorization?
Information typically required includes patient details, provider information, medication details (including ingredients), diagnosis codes, and rationale for the compound's use, along with any relevant clinical notes.
